Comments Sought on Dutch Harbor Dredging Project

The U.S. Army Corps of Engineers is preparing a Draft Interim Feasibility Report for the Unalaska Channels, also known as Dutch Harbor.

The proposed project and preliminary analysis of potential environmental impacts are described in the draft report.

The report is being submitted to elicit public review and comment on the Corps’ tentatively selected plan to dredge a bar at the entrance to Iliuliuk Bay.

According to the Corps, the bar shallower than the surrounding bathymetry located at the entrance to Iliuliuk Bay currently limits access to Dutch Harbor. Based on the most recent NOAA bathymetry, the depth at the bar is -42 feet MLLW.

The report will be available for comments until June 29.
